Re: Axanthic Super Pastel Spider (Axanthic killer bee)!
 Originally Posted by flameethrower
If it makes no sense then correct what you see wrong.
100% het albino x 50% het albino will give a chance of albino and will then produce 50% phet albinos.
If You get Albinos from 100% Het x 50% Het that makes the 50% Het a 100% Het...The "Normals" would then be 66% Hets.

Re: Axanthic Super Pastel Spider (Axanthic killer bee)!
 Originally Posted by Andrew24
ooooh you can't get a 100% het when both parents are 100% het?? well how would you get a 100% het then???
The hets.
No, you would get 66% poss hets, to get 100% hets you need to breed a visual recessive morph.
